Job Description:

Roles & Responsibilities

Test Automation Strategy & Leadership

  • Define and execute the test automation strategy across Finance and Risk portfolios.
  • Establish automation standards, frameworks, and best practices aligned with enterprise QE objectives.
  • Drive shift-left testing and continuous testing adoption across Agile and DevOps teams.
  • Create automation roadmaps to improve quality, speed, and cost efficiency.

Automation Framework Development

  • Design, develop, and maintain scalable automation frameworks for:
    • API Testing
    • UI Testing
    • ETL/Data Validation Testing
    • Regression Testing
    • Batch and Mainframe Testing
  • Ensure frameworks are reusable, maintainable, and integrated with CI/CD pipelines.

Finance & Risk Domain Quality Assurance

  • Lead automation initiatives for:
    • Regulatory Reporting
    • Financial Reporting
    • Risk Management Systems
    • Basel and Capital Reporting
    • Credit Risk, Market Risk, and Liquidity Risk Platforms
  • Validate complex financial calculations, data transformations, and reporting controls.

Data Quality & ETL Testing

  • Develop automated validation solutions for large-scale data warehouses and risk data platforms.
  • Automate reconciliation between source systems, staging layers, and reporting platforms.
  • Ensure data lineage, completeness, accuracy, and integrity across Finance and Risk applications.

DevOps & CI/CD Enablement

  • Integrate automation suites into CI/CD pipelines.
  • Enable automated test execution within build and deployment processes.
  • Establish quality gates and release readiness criteria.
  • Monitor automation execution results and quality metrics.

AI & Intelligent Testing

  • Drive adoption of AI-enabled testing solutions.
  • Implement self-healing automation capabilities and intelligent test generation.
  • Leverage predictive analytics to identify risk-prone areas and optimize test coverage.
  • Explore GenAI opportunities to improve QE productivity and efficiency.

Governance & Quality Metrics

  • Define KPIs and quality dashboards for automation effectiveness.
  • Track automation coverage, defect leakage, execution efficiency, and release quality.
  • Ensure compliance with enterprise risk, audit, and regulatory standards.
  • Participate in quality governance forums and architecture reviews.

Stakeholder & Vendor Management

  • Partner with Business, Technology, Product Owners, and Program Leadership.
  • Collaborate with Architecture teams to influence quality-by-design practices.
  • Manage vendor teams and ensure delivery aligns with quality objectives.
  • Provide executive-level updates on automation progress and risk mitigation.

Team Leadership & Capability Building

  • Mentor QE Leads, Automation Engineers, and SDETs.
  • Build automation capabilities across multiple delivery pods.
  • Conduct framework reviews, code reviews, and technical coaching.
  • Drive a culture of continuous improvement, innovation, and engineering excellence.

Continuous Improvement

  • Identify opportunities to reduce manual testing effort through automation.
  • Improve test execution efficiency and release cycle times.
  • Standardize testing processes across Finance and Risk programs.
  • Promote engineering practices that enhance scalability, reliability, and operational resilience.

Key Success Measures

  • Automation Coverage (%)
  • Reduction in Regression Testing Effort
  • Release Quality & Defect Leakage
  • CI/CD Adoption Rate
  • Test Execution Efficiency
  • Regulatory Compliance Readiness
  • Cost Savings through Automation & AI
  • QE Team Capability Growth and Maturity

Experience and/or Education

  • BS degree in Computer Science or related Engineering discipline; or equivalent practical experience
  • Strong academic background (e.g., software engineering, computer science)
  • 5-7 years of relevant experience
